How do I start a free online tournament

To enter a tournament in the casino of your choice, the first thing you have to do is to find the tournament(s) section in the casino lobby. Take a look around in the main menu. Generally it is there under some tab. Create an Alias; this is the name that will be displayed in the tournament Leader Board. It is not the same as your casino username. Once in the right part you will see the current tournaments. Now you have to make a choice which one you are going to enter. In the beginning, you will first make a choice based on your feelings. That is very normal. As you gain more experience playing tournaments, you will make other choices and develop a preference for certain casinos, certain software or any other reason. Sometimes you have to pay a buy in what we explain lateron. Anyway with a free tournament, you can start playing immediately. So, it may be clear that the starting process does vary from casino to casino. Anyway, our advice is to start with free online tournaments if you have never played tournaments before. What means Re Buy

Online tournaments offer quite common a re-buy option. Re-buy includes that you get another shot at the same tournament but, as the name indicates, you have to pay a fee to get that ‘replay’. How much does a re buy cost? Difficult to say because the fee varies from tournament to tournament, and from casino to casino. So, it is your personal choice (and your cash). The 'Re-Buy' button lets you reset your score to zero and start building it again. Don’t worry, you never lose your highest score when you re-buy, you can only get a higher score or keep the one you have. You may re-buy as many times as stated in the rules of your selected tournament.

What means Continues

Continues include the chance to continue the tournament where you had to stop playing because time ran out. At this point, you can continue playing if you pay for a fee. In this way you can continue playing with your current score and thus get a better score with more chance to win the tournament. Continues are exclusive to Microgaming tournaments and that is the reason why the microgaming software tournaments are so popular with online casino players. Unfortunately, microgaming tourneys are not accessible to US players. This means that US players can only play free tournaments at RTG and WGS casinos. If you are going to compare re-buy and continue, you will realize that the continue option is more interesting than the re-buy option to earn a higher score and possibly to win a tournament.

What is a scheduled tournament

A scheduled tournament has a fixed start time and a fixed end time. In other words: you can only enter these tournaments when they are 'open' and this is mentioned on the casino's website. How long is a tournament open? That varies from a few minutes to i.e. a whole month or six weeks etc… Tournaments end promptly at the published time. The longer a tournament runs, the bigger the prize pools. On the other hand: the longer a tournament runs, more players can enter and take part so it is more difficult to win such a tournament. Scheduled tournaments offer often Re-buys.

What is a Sit-and-Go tournament

A sit and go tournament has no fixed start time. This kind of tournament is open until enough players have entered and then the competition starts. Generally, these tournaments do not run for a long time, count less players and offer a smaller prize pool. It should be clear that, due to the fact that fewer players participate, you are more likely to win a prize and, who knows, even win a sit and go tournament. Re-buys are not allowed here.

Free Roll Tournaments

Free Roll Tournaments are tournaments which do not require that players pay a registration fee. Winnings from Free Roll tournaments are subject to the same terms and conditions as the standard tournament winnings. Finally a few tips for beginners!

• Before your start to play, check if No Deposit Bonuses and Free chips may be used to enter tournaments. In a lot of casinos, this is NOT allowed.
• To know your stand/rank in the tournament, look anywhere on your screen for a sort of 'Rank'-feature (at the bottom, at the right corner etc.). If you see two numbers, then the first number is your position in the competition and the second number is the total amount of players competing for the pool prize.
• The 'Leaderboard'-button shows the positions of all the players, including their credits.
• 'Time Remaining'-feature: check this feature regularly because it tells you how much time you’ve got left to play! It is in general at the bottom of your screen but depends on the casino’s website lay out.
• 'Prize'-feature: the more players that compete the tournament, the more members get paid. As more players join, the prizes will automatically adjust. To check the winning values, use this feature. Good luck and have tons of fun and luck!
